A woman walks near a cut off of the wall of a damaged building from where a group people tried to steal a work of the famous British artist Banksy in the town of Gostomel, near Kyiv, on December 3, 2022, amid the Russian invasion of Ukraine. - Ukraine has detained eight people over the theft from a wall in the Kyiv suburbs of a mural painted by elusive British street artist Banksy, the authorities said. "A group of people tried to steal a Banksy mural. They cut out the work from the wall of a house destroyed by the Russians," Kyiv governor Oleksiy Kuleba said in a post on Telegram.
